The Federal Government has announced plan to pay the outstanding five months N35,000 wage award arrears to workers.
This was made known in a statement issued on Monday from the Office of the Accountant General of the Federation (OAGF) by Bawa Mokwa, the Director of Press and Public Relations.
According to Mokwa, the Federal Government had earlier paid five months wage award in instalments.
He said that the outstanding arrears would be paid in installments of N35,000 per month for five months.
The first installment of the outstanding wage award arrears would be paid after the April 2025 salary.
“The wage award arrears will not be paid with the April 2025 salary; it will come immediately after the salary is paid”, he said.
He noted that the Federal Government was determined to fully implement all policies and agreements regarding staff remuneration and welfare to enhance productivity and efficiency.
